How much do sleep lab man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for sleep lab manager in Reno, NV is $91,691.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$69,800.00 and $110,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the sleep lab manager position, and why are they important?

To excel as a Sleep Lab Manager, you typically need experience in sleep medicine, management, and polysomnography, along with relevant credentials such as RPSGT (Registered Polysomnographic Technologist) or similar certifications. Familiarity with sleep study equipment, laboratory information systems, and regulatory standards (like AASM accreditation) is essential. Strong leadership, organizational, and communication skills distinguish top candidates in this role. These abilities are crucial for ensuring accurate test results, maintaining operational efficiency, and fostering a collaborative team environment in sleep laboratory settings.

What is a sleep lab manager?

A Sleep Lab Manager oversees the operations of a sleep center, ensuring high-quality patient care and compliance with medical and regulatory standards. They manage staff, schedule sleep studies, maintain equipment, and handle administrative tasks like budgeting and reporting. Additionally, they work closely with physicians and technologists to diagnose and treat sleep disorders. Their role is crucial in maintaining efficiency and accuracy in sleep studies, ultimately improving patient outcomes.

What are the typical daily or weekly responsibilities of a sleep lab manager?

As a Sleep Lab Manager, your responsibilities usually include overseeing the day-to-day operations of the sleep lab, managing staff schedules, and ensuring compliance with accreditation and safety standards. You may review and interpret sleep study data, troubleshoot equipment, and coordinate with referring physicians to ensure optimal patient care. Additionally, you’ll be involved in training and developing technologists, maintaining accurate documentation, and implementing quality improvement initiatives. Your role is both supervisory and hands-on, requiring a balance of clinical expertise, administrative oversight, and effective team leadership.

Job description

Position Purpose:

Reporting to the Sleep Center Manager, Sleep Technicians perform overnight sleep studies to assist in the evaluation and treatment of sleep patient in compliance with AASM guidelines.

Nature and Scope:

Sleep Study Preparation and Set-up

1. Collect, analyze and integrate patient information in order to identify and meet the patient-specific needs (physical/mental limitations, current emotional/physiological status regarding the testing procedure, pertinent medical/social history).

 2. Determine final testing parameters/procedures in conjunction with the ordering physician or clinical director and laboratory protocols.

 3. Review the patient's history and verify the medical order.

4. Follow sleep center protocols related to the sleep study.

5. When patient arrives, verify identification, collect documents and obtain consent for the study.

 6. Explain the procedure and orient the patient for either in center or out of center sleep testing.

 7. Select appropriate equipment and calibrate for testing to determine proper functioning and make adjustments, if necessary.

 8. Apply electrodes and sensors according to accepted published standards.

9. Perform routine positive airway pressure (PAP) interface fitting and desensitization.

Sleep Study Procedures

1. Demonstrate the knowledge and skills necessary to recognize and provide age specific care in the treatment, assessment, and education of neonatal, pediatric, adolescent, adult, and geriatric patients.

 2. Demonstrate the knowledge and skills necessary to perform portable monitoring equipment preparation and data download.

 3. Perform patient education and instruction appropriate for out of center sleep testing.

 4. Demonstrate adherence to cleaning and disinfection procedures for portable monitoring devices.

 5. Demonstrate adherence to AASM scoring parameters for OCST; identify artifact, inadequate signals and study failures and generate an accurate report.
